,1. Multiple Choice: Which of the following is a key feature of
Electronic Health Records (EHR)?
a) Interoperability
b) Low-cost
c) Time-consuming documentation
d) Limited access to patient history
Answer: a) Interoperability
Rationale: Interoperability is a fundamental characteristic of
EHRs, allowing for the seamless exchange and use of information
across different healthcare systems.
2. Fill-in-the-Blank: __________ is the process of ensuring that the
data entered into an informatics system reflects the true state of the
patient.
Answer: Data validation
Rationale: Data validation is crucial in biomedical informatics to
maintain the accuracy and reliability of patient records.
